3. Question: After installing the Samsung USB driver on my Windows XP computer, I am encountering an error message when connecting the device. What steps should I take?
Answer: Check if the USB debugging option is enabled on your Samsung device. To enable USB debugging, go to "Settings" > "Developer Options" (if available) > "USB Debugging." If you cannot find the "Developer Options" menu, go to "Settings" > "About Phone" > Tap on "Build Number" seven times to enable Developer Options. Reconnect your device to your computer after enabling USB debugging.
